How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ashland?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Ashland Studio Apartments | $1,578 | $1,550 | $1,599 |
| Ashland 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,978 | $1,400 | $2,489 |
| Ashland 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,673 | $1,999 | $3,729 |
Ashland 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,955 | $2,440 | $7,681 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Ashland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Ashland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Ashland is $3,955.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Ashland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Ashland is a 1,100 square feet unit starting from $2,795 at Fairmount Palms.
